You will learn to

Apply a guideline you disagree with, and move the disagreement to where it can change the guideline.

Why this matters

Your labels are compared with everyone else's. A quiet exception makes the data disagree with itself and leaves no record of why.

Three things to remember

  • Where the guideline decides the case, the guideline wins over your taste.
  • Send your disagreement as a separate note, not as a changed label.
  • Quote the guideline line you applied whenever a case was close.
